Scoping

Scoping is done to identify which potential impacts are relevant to asses (based on
legislative requirements, international conventions, expert knowledge and public
involvement.

The project covered all the contents of a Project Brief. A description of the
project, an analysis of alternatives that were considered, a description of the
biophysical and socio-economic conditions of the area, a description of policy and
legal requirements of the project, an outline of issues and concerns of
stakeholders, an assessment of all possible impacts of the project; and alternative
approaches or mitigation measures that have been developed in order to avoid,
minimize, remedy or compensate for the potential negative impacts and enhance
the potential benefits of the project.
